Canorous and Raucous

Canorous

Canorous adjective - Having a pleasing mixture of notes.
Usage example: a canorous chorus of birdsong filled the morning air

Raucous is an antonym for canorous.

Raucous

Raucous adjective - Being rough or noisy in a high-spirited way.

Canorous is an antonym for raucous.
